Описание

The keyctl_read_key function in security/keys/keyctl.c in the Linux kernel before 4.3.4 does not properly use a semaphore, which allows local users to cause a denial of service (NULL pointer dereference and system crash) or possibly have unspecified other impact via a crafted application that leverages a race condition between keyctl_revoke and keyctl_read calls.

A NULL-pointer dereference flaw was found in the kernel, which is caused by a race between revoking a user-type key and reading from it. The issue could be triggered by an unprivileged user with a local account, causing the kernel to crash (denial of service).

Отчет

This issue affects the Linux kernels as shipped with Red Hat Enterprise Linux 5,6 and 7 and may be addressed in a future update.
